How to Identify copyright German Banknotes
Thankfully, the ECB has included a number of innovative security functions into euro banknotes to make counterfeiting as hard as possible. By understanding and utilizing these features, both individuals and businesses can protect themselves from falling victim to copyright money.

Key Security Features to Check:
Feel the Paper
Authentic copyright are printed on cotton-based paper, making them long lasting and somewhat textured. copyright costs are frequently printed on regular paper or products that feel smoother.

Tilt the Note
copyright integrate holographic features. When slanted, the hologram spot or strip on the front of the note ought to display changing images or colors.

Inspect the Watermark
Hold the banknote approximately the light. Real copyright consist of a watermark that becomes visible and shows the banknote's worth and a portrait of Europa, a figure from Greek mythology.

Magnify the Microprint
Little lettering on genuine copyright is crisp and clear, even under zoom. On counterfeits, the text may appear blurred or irregular.

Usage UV Light
Under ultraviolet light, genuine euro banknotes display security threads, lively functions, and patterns. copyright bills might either radiance unnaturally or do not have these elements entirely.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s).
1. Is it prohibited to unintentionally use a copyright banknote?
If an individual unknowingly utilizes a copyright note, they usually can not be held criminally liable. However, they might still face the monetary loss, as copyright currency can not be exchanged for legal tender.

2. What should I do if I presume I've received a copyright note?
If you believe a banknote is copyright, you ought to right away report it to the nearby bank or law enforcement authority. Prevent returning it to the individual who offered it to you, as this may be considered scams.

3. Can copyright-detector pens dependably determine copyright?
While copyright-detector pens can supply some indicator of credibility, they are not foolproof. Checking multiple security functions is the most trusted method.

4. Are EUR500 notes more most likely to be copyright?
The EUR500 note has actually frequently been related to illegal activities due to its high worth and has been ceased for production. Nevertheless, they are still legal tender, and while copyright EUR500 notes exist, other denominations like EUR20 and EUR50 are more commonly targeted.

5. Who supervises the design and security of euro banknotes?
The European Central Bank (ECB) and the nationwide central banks of the Eurozone, consisting of Germany's Bundesbank, are accountable for designing and keeping the security features of euro banknotes.
